You might give a look at the 10 tine version of the grapple on the link above.  It would be the 'Gorilla Grapple'.  I've got the 6 tine version 'Gregory Grapple' and I'm impressed completely with it.  I firmly believe if anything is going to get bent it will be the arms on the skidsteer and nothing on the grapple itself.  Built like a brick sh!thouse.  Over built really is a more accurate description, heavy as hell but it ain't gonna bend. 

I'd like to have a 10 tine version, but I found the six tine at an auction and it was like new for less than half price.  The six tine version is lacking when it comes to raking up small stuff. 

As for using it like a ripper, it'll stand up to what ever you can push or pull with the bottom or top sections.  And without the bracing between the tines, it can go in as deep as you have traction or power to put it.
